Eva-Last appoints Craig Parker as Chief Operations Officer

Eva-Last has announced the appointment of Craig Parker as Chief Operations Officer – heralding a new phase of growth for the building materials group.

Since its inception in South Africa, Eva-Last has grown at a rapid rate to become a global leader in the composite materials decking and cladding markets. Worldwide demand for the group’s products has seen Eva-Last embark on a growth strategy which will double the size of the organisation. Parker, who was previously Divisional CEO: Road Freight Management & Contract Logistics at Imperial Logistics South Africa, represents Eva-Last’s most senior appointment to date.

The story of how VistaClad clipped into place

As far back as the Dark Ages cladding – then known as “weatherboarding”, using what were called clapboards – has been used in architecture to beautify building exteriors. Originally mostly made of split boards from oak or elm trees, cladding was soon in vogue across Europe and purpose-sawn cladding boards were being sold to create attractive natural aesthetic appeal for structures of all kinds.

Revolutionising commercial and residential outdoor décor

South Africans love being outdoors. The country’s climate is well suited to a lifestyle that takes advantage of hot, sunny days and beautiful natural surroundings. Adapting our living and working spaces to this nature-loving lifestyle has frequently employed timber products as decking, cladding and decorative features. However, although natural timber provides desirable aesthetic benefits, wood requires constant upkeep and replacement because it struggles to maintain its original finish when exposed to climatic conditions.
